It's not a big deal.....Enterprise Rent A Car has an exotics division in some major cities/markets. I've rented different exotics from them while on vacation and they require specific proof from your insurance company that you'll be covered. Your insurance company knows what you're doing and agrees to what you're doing. Hertz has proof that you are covered for the value of the car and off you go....really simple since everybody and everything is covered should the SHTF. Once you get to know the agent and they see your rental history, you can often negotiate more free miles than what is posted.
I'm guessing a Z06 will run close to $1000.00 per day....that already weeds out a lot of people that may be "problematic".
